Love Divine

by Annie B © 2024

Oh, boundless sea of love so pure and bright,
Which fills our hearts with heaven's light,
Where we behold the face of God so true,
Reflected in the mirror of the Word anew.

In ancient texts, a whisper soft and clear,
His sacred truths, of His Love, we revere.
Where once we dwelt in shadowed lands,
Now, by Your grace, in brotherhood, we stand.

Behold, the children of the One above,
Whose very essence is the heart of love.
We marvel at the Source so vast and high,
Which brought forth eternal life so we will never die.

Human love that is not but a fleeting breeze,
Where selfishness and pride kill God's peace.
But Love that's born of Him, so deep and vast,
Can conquer all, from first to the very last.

In every act, in every tender word,
In every thought , through Him, we've been heard.
For in our weakness, He's made us strong,
And in our hearts, we've been cleansed from wrong.

All fear and doubt into the sea of grace,
Where we may rise and touch Your face.
Now we are known, as we have been loved,
Our hearts are forever intertwined above.

In this world marred by doubt and pain,
We're born of God and shall remain.
As He is pure, so let us be,
Reflecting His love in all we see.

Oh Love Divine, our hearts' true guide,
In God alone, we live and we abide.
Through every trial, through every storm,
His perfect Love will keep us warm.

For now, we see through a glass,
Soon we'll know as we are known to pass.
Into the realm where love reigns,
Where every tear is wiped away by pain.

Till that great day when we shall see,
God's love that's everlastingly free,
And with the angels, we shall cry,
"Worthy is the Lamb", our souls reply.

For in this life, we but prepare,
To meet our God in Heaven's atmosphere,
Where God's love in fullness we shall know,
And every heart will softly glow.

Lord God, our hearts to You we give,
Let us in purity, in You we shall live.
As children of the promise vast,
In Your embrace, forever last.
